    Promoting to W-3 here adds $108 a month. The pay chart moves this allowance far less than the map does.

    01

    Where you are stationed outweighs what you are paid. Moving from Buffalo to Westchester County at W-2 is worth $3,369 a month — about 31 promotions worth of housing allowance, at $108 per grade here.

    02

    Dependency status is worth 17% here. That is a status your finance office determines, not a box you tick — and it is the single largest lever on this page that is not a change of address.

    03

    None of it is taxed. $2,667 a month of BAH takes more than $2,667 of basic pay to match, which is why comparing a civilian salary against military base pay alone understates the gap.

    Things the rate table doesn't tell you

    01

    “With dependents” is a dependency status, not a marital status. A single member paying child support can be authorized BAH-Diff; a married dual-military couple with no children is not automatically the with-dependents rate for both. If your situation is unusual, your finance office decides — not this table.

    02

    O-8, O-9 and O-10 draw the same BAH as O-7. The table stops there for a reason, not because it is missing rows.

    03

    This is CONUS BAH only. Overseas is OHA, which works differently — it reimburses actual rent up to a cap, with separate utility and move-in allowances. Alaska and Hawaii are BAH; Germany, Japan and Korea are OHA.
